90 Day challenge with the Picture Smart Bible

Bible Reading Challenge . Katie's Ramblings

So we have completed a week of reading so far.  We started reading the New Testament on June 1st, and we plan to read all the way through it in 90 days.  We decided to add a little fun to it and use our picture smart Bible program.

This program is a fun way to help us remember what we are reading and learning by drawing and coloring images.

picture smart

We have used this program with family Bible study of other books of the Bible and enjoy it.  Recently, they put out a K-3 version of the program.  SO, I purchased it to use with the little ones.  It is a very cute and simple coloring page.

The program is very easy to use and each book of the Bible has simple commentary for the images as the children color them.  I personally do not always use the commentary.  Instead, we read the Bible chapters and then discuss them.  One of the things that I do not enjoy about the program is that often the commentary and images are not in chapter order.  Instead, the images and commentary are in topic order.  So, it can be tricky jumping from one chapter to another pointing out the themes.

The best way to make this work is to read the chapters for the day and then go back and discuss the images and themes of those chapters.

The picture smart bible is very nicely done and easy to use, both the original version and the new K-3 version.  But, I will say it is not ideal to use both versions together in family Bible study.  They don’t work together well.  Instead of using both versions together.  I suggest if you have teens and young children doing study together just use the older version. The student sheet for the older kids requires tracing and writing of words.  So, to make it usable for my little ones I just print the teachers sheet, which is like a coloring sheet.

Things to know as you visit our site

We are Bible believing, scripture only people.  We love to learn about the Hebrew roots of our faith.  We believe it is important to not add or subtract from the Divine Word of God.  The compiled scriptures that agree with one another and have no contradiction is the 66 books of what is commonly referred to as the Christian Bible, or the Holy Bible.

These writings were originally written by men inspired by God.  They were written in the language of the writers and readers of the original documents.  Many of the original documents have been lost, but God’s Word is eternal and remains.  Therefore, it is important to us to study, learn, and consider the culture, history, and language of the original writers of the scriptures.

In our studies we have learned that the true name of God is Yehovah, and His son, our Messiah, is named Yeshua.  Therefore, as you read our posts we will use the Hebrew names of God and our Messiah.
